猪肌肉组织表达序列标签(ESTs)的分析

民猪;背最长肌;表达序列标签;基因表达谱
摘  要:
研究构建了民猪肌肉组织cDNA文库,并在文库中随机挑选克隆进行测序,获得107个高质量的ESTs。经生物信息学分析,所研究的107个ESTs中,有98个单一克隆,其中71个为人类及其他物种的同源序列,23个为猪的已知ESTs,4个为未知ESTs。对这4个未知ESTs进行开放阅读框预测并进行BLASTn分析,没有找到高度同源的氨基酸序列。对已知功能基因表达谱的构建和分析结果表明:最多的是未分类,占47.88%;然后依次是基因/蛋白表达占26.76%、细胞代谢占9.86%、细胞结构/迁移占8.45%、细胞/机体防御占4.23%和细胞信号/传导占2.82%。

Analysis of expressed sequence tags in pig skeletal muscle

Min Pig;longissimus dorsi muscle;expressed sequence tags;gene expression profile
摘  要:
A Longissimus dorsi muscle cDNA library of Min Pig was constructed and 107 high quality ESTs were obtained in this study.By bioinformatics analysis,98 unique clones ware identified : 71 showed homology to previously identified genes in human or other mammals,23 matched uncharacterized expressed sequence tags(ESTs),four showed no significant matches to sequences already present in DNA databases.We have predicted the open read frame of the four unknown ESTs and analyzed the idendity by using BLAST.The match sequences of amino acid have not been found between the translation of the four ESTs and the protein database.By constructing and analyzing the known gene expression profile,we found that the largest class of genes represented those involved in unclassified(47.88%).The class was followed by genes involved in gene/protein expression(26.76%),metabolism(9.86%),cell structure/motility(8.45%),cell/organism defense(4.23%),and cell signaling/communication(2.82%).
